## Offline mode — TerraQuill field app

Quick context before you review: when surveyors lose signal out past the Kelvane ridge sites, TerraQuill flips into offline mode and queues submissions in the local store. Sync kicks in automatically once connectivity returns, with exponential backoff so we don't hammer the gateway. The tricky bit is the conflict window — if two devices edit the same plot record offline, last-write-wins applies unless the merge flag is set. All of this behavior is driven by the values below.

config for kafof-bawef:
holath:
  log_level: debug
  metrics_host: metrics.holath.qorvelsys.internal
  pin: 2191
  pool_size: 32

**Runbook: running the Thumbwright batch resizer**

Quick heads-up for reviewers: the `thumbwright resize` command fans out across worker threads, so output ordering isn't deterministic — don't flag that in review, it's expected. Do check that any new flags respect the `--dry-run` path, since ops at Pellgrove rely on it before big runs. Memory spikes above 2 GB usually mean someone skipped the `--stream` flag. Full flag semantics, exit codes, and the approval checklist are kept on the internal runbook page.

operations page: https://jira.zemvarlabs.internal/browse/pages/pages/projects

Ticket: INV-884 — PDF invoices clip the totals row

Heads up for the sync: the Papermoth renderer chops off the totals row on invoices with more than 14 line items.

Repro:
1. Create a Brindleworks test order with 15+ items.
2. Trigger invoice generation from the admin panel.
3. Open the PDF — totals are gone.

To regenerate a sample against the render service, use the bearer token below.

session JWT of yawep-yawep = eyJhbGciOiJIUzI1NiIsInR5cCI6IkpXVCJ9.eyJzdWIiOiI3pWF3_In0.aXYsHiog

**Key Ceremony Checklist — Item 7: Telemetry Payload Compression**

Before sealing the ceremony record, confirm that the Veldrin telemetry agent is set to zstd level 6 for all payloads leaving the Harrowgate enclave. Uncompressed batches will exceed the audit channel's size cap and the ceremony log will reject them. Verify the compression flag in the agent config, run one test batch, and have the witness initial the result sheet. Once the witness signs off, record the recovery passphrase exactly as read aloud below.

strongbox words: sorir-belvan-rusix-ulays-ralmir-praix-eliir-tamax-praael-druael-julir-tamius-jorir